When evaluating the validity of a website beyond its URL, you can practice the "Rule of 3" which means:

A. Look at 3 different pages from the same website

B. Compare 3 sources of information about the topic

C. Find 3 people in the classroom who agree with your opinion

D. Make sure that the URL for the website has 3 different extensions in it

Answer:

B. Compare 3 sources of information about the topic

Explanation:

To evaluate the validity of a website is to determine whether the website will give the needed information at that given point in time. In other words, it is the assessment of a website to know if it serves the actual purpose it claims to serve.

In order to evaluate the validity of a website, one can do the following amongst others:

1. Pick the opinions or ideas are missing

2. Consider publisher the of information

3. How professional the website looks

4. Consider the domain extension for the site

5. Look for the date of publishing

However, rule of three to evaluate the validity of a website is to then B. Compare 3 sources of information about the topic
